No. 11 Arizona Finishes Competition at the Pac-12 South Invitational

No. 11 Arizona finished competition at the Pac-12 South Invitational on Sunday. The Wildcats fell 4-1 in both of the day's matches against No. 4 USC and No. 16 California and now stand at 9-7 on the season.

In Arizona's first match of the day, the team fell 4-1 to the 4th-ranked USC Trojans in their first matchup of the season. The No. 5 pair of Jonny Baham and Brooke Burling earned the Cats lone victory over the Trojans Cammie Dorn and Maja Kaiser in three sets, 11-21, 21-19, 16-14.

No. 16 California defeated the Wildcats 4-1 with Arizona's No. 2 team notching a victory. California's Jessica Gaffney and Iya Lindahl fell to Cats Olivia Hallaran and Kacey Nady, 23-25, 19-21. UA will face No. 16 California in the next home tournament, the Wildcat Spring Challenge on April 7.

Next up, Arizona will head to Baton Rouge, La to compete in the LSU Tournament, the Cats fifth consecutive road tournament, starting on March 30.


Full Results

No. 4 USC def. No. 11 Arizona, 4-1
2018 Pac-12 South Invitational
Ocean Park Beach • Santa Monica, Calif.
Sunday, March 25, 2018
Records:
USC (14-6), Arizona (9-6)

1. Abril Bustamante/Tina Graudina (USC) def. Natalie Anselmo/Olivia Macdonald (ARIZ) 21-9, 25-23
2. Terese Cannon/Sammy Slater (USC) def. Olivia Hallaran/Kacey Nady (ARIZ) 21-15, 24-22
3. Joy Dennis/Halley Halgren (USC) def. Makenna Martin/Mia Mason (ARIZ) 18-21, 21-16, 15-9
4. Jenna Belton/Jo Kremer (USC) def. Hailey Devlin/Stephany Purdue (ARIZ) 13-21, 21-12, 15-9
5. Jonny Baham/Brooke Burling (ARIZ) def. Cammie Dorn/Maja Kaiser (USC) 11-21, 21-19, 16-14
Order of finish: 1, 2, 4*, 5, 3

No. 16 California def. No. 11 Arizona, 4-1
2018 Pac-12 South Invitational
Ocean Park Beach • Santa Monica, Calif.
Sunday, March 25, 2018
Records: California (13-3), Arizona (9-7)

1. Alexia Inman/Mima Mirkovic (CAL) def. Natalie Anselmo/Olivia Macdonald (ARIZ) 21-18, 21-19
2. Olivia Hallaran/Kacey Nady (ARIZ) def. Jessica Gaffney/Iya Lindahl (CAL) 25-23, 21-19
3. Bryce Bark/Madison Dueck (CAL) def. Makenna Martin/Mia Mason (ARIZ) 21-14, 23-21
4. Caroline Schafer/Mia Merino (CAL) def. Hailey Devlin/Stephany Purdue (ARIZ) 21-19, 21-19
5. Grace Campbell/Madison Micheletti (CAL) def. Jonny Baham/Brooke Burling (ARIZ) 21-15, 21-9
Order of finish: 5, 1, 3*, 4, 2
